Prioritize Your Profile Authenticity
Fake or manipulated listings are easy targets for AI scanners, especially with increasing sophistication in 2026. To solidify your position, ensure every element of your Google My Business (GMB) profile is genuine and consistent across platforms. A real address, accurate contact information, and regular activity signals to AI that your listing is trustworthy. I once corrected inconsistent contact info across directories, which resulted in a 15% boost in rankings within two weeks. Leverage Local Sentiment Data Effectively
AI filters are now analyzing local sentiment signals—such as reviews and social mentions—to gauge authenticity. Encourage satisfied customers to leave detailed reviews that mention your location specifically, avoiding generic praise. Respond promptly to reviews, especially negative ones, to demonstrate active management. I implemented a review prompt after service completion, which increased my review count by 20%, positively impacting rankings. Optimize Visual Content for Search Clues
AI scans images for clues about your business type and location. Use “Google-friendly” photos—high-quality, geo-tagged, and relevant—of your storefront, interior, and area landmarks. Avoid generic stock photos. I enhanced my profile by adding geo-tagged images, resulting in improved map placement. Including descriptive alt text and titles simplifies AI analysis. Develop Content That Resonate Locally
Incorporate localized keywords naturally into your business descriptions, FAQs, and services. Use terms that locals frequently search, such as neighborhood names and landmarks—these are signals AI algorithms favor. I added location-specific FAQs, which significantly boosted my map presence for niche searches. To master local content tactics, visit local map SEO content strategies.

Staying ahead in local SEO requires more than just initial setup; it demands consistent maintenance and refined tools to adapt to the ever-changing map ranking landscape. In my experience, leveraging the right equipment and software is crucial for long-term success. One tool I swear by is BrightLocal, which provides detailed citation tracking, reputation management, and local rank monitoring. Unlike generic analytics platforms, BrightLocal offers granular insights specifically tailored for local SEO, enabling me to identify dips in rankings instantly and respond proactively.
Another essential resource is GMB Dashboard, which allows real-time monitoring of your Google My Business profile performance. I utilize it to track review patterns, engagement metrics, and profile health. This immediate visibility helps prevent subtle issues from snowballing into ranking drops, especially critical given AI filters’ sophistication in 2026.
To streamline routine maintenance, I rely on SEMrush’s Position Tracking. Its localization features allow me to track rankings across different neighborhoods and adapt tactics accordingly. Regularly auditing these metrics ensures my map assets stay optimized against evolving AI scrutiny.
